The Paupatri restaurant is considered one of the best and most secretive in Boracay, hidden in the shade of the woods and quiet. The restaurant is actually a tree house with smooth wooden floors and tables and chairs, and you need to take off your shoes when you enter the restaurant. The restaurant also uses wood vines to isolate a private room, sitting in it chatting and dining, which has a special flavor. Paupatri's bold use of a fully open kitchen allows guests to see the complete production process and eat more at ease. Every Filipino cuisine provided by the restaurant has been carefully cooked, and there are many varieties of grilled fish; transparent; garlic rice; sour soup, sour soup is special, very representative, sour and sweet, it is really unsatisfactory. Per capita consumption is about 900 pesos, which is still very affordable!
